The protagonists of the film are three brothers: Eino, Aho and Laje. The brothers live from the cultivation of the family land. Eino works from dawn to night. Aho likes to spend time playing at a nearby inn. Laje once helps Eino, and once accompanies Aho. Once Aho gets cheated by playing dice and losing his family land. The brothers set off in search of a job. They reach a road fork. Eino wants to go left, Aho to the right, and Laje agrees once with one, once with the other brother. The brothers, unable to convince each other for their reasons, start a great quarrel.

Directed by Zbigniew Kotecki · Written by Jan Zamojski

A film from the "Impressions" series, created using classical animation techniques, executed with painting on celluloid. The viewer's guide through selected paintings by Marc Chagall is the figure of the Jew – the Eternal Wanderer, a symbol of the artist's feelings and experiences. Through the composition of selected paintings or their fragments, the film evokes the artist's life experiences and his self-definition of the world. The nostalgic atmosphere of longing for his native Vitebsk, the realities of his stay in Paris, his return to Russia, and the experiences of the revolution, "inscribed" in the poetics of Chagall's paintings, create a unique atmosphere within the film narrative, created by the artist's imagination.

A film miniature for classical music inspired by the music of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art. The form of a luminous line following the rhythm and tempo of the music creates musical instruments suspended in space. The line runs through a city lit up by neon lights, tracing surreal, abstract shapes, only to transform them into dancing silhouettes a moment later. The sounds of the music change the intensity of the light from white and black to a full range of colors vibrating to the rhythm of the music.

A film to classical music made using the pixilation technique - animation of a live set with a time-lapse camera. Panorama of the city shown to the rhythm of music imitating the rhythm of the flight of a bumblebee. The camera here plays the role of eyes - it is from the point of view of the flight of the insect that the world is shown. The image of the roofs of houses is coming closer or moving away. A chimney sweep standing on the roof abruptly dodges something flying at him...
